Good Nutrition, Good Bees by David Aston & Sally Bucknall Specialist This project began as anThe importance of pollinator species to mans survival and the functioning of the worlds ecosystems is recognised. Environmental and other stressors have taken their toll on many pollinator species and their abundance. The European Honey bee (Apis mellifera) and man have had a long mutually beneficial relationship and it is vital that this continues.
